On Saturday 4 April, the monthly educational ‘Pindacāra’ Programme at Sri Petaling and Happy Garden markets was held with three venerable Sangha members going on alms-round.  Nalanda Founder, Bro. Tan, volunteers and devotees participated joyfully in offering food to the Sangha members.

After the alms-round, Director of Nalanda Dharma School, Sis. Sunanda gave a lively Dhamma sharing on the five duties of a good student towards the teacher.  She quoted from the ‘Sigalovada Sutta’ and elaborated that a dutiful student rises from the seat in salutation on seeing the teacher; attends on the teacher; performs  personal service; with eagerness to learn; and pays respectful attention while receiving instructions.
